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"Sorry for the error" is correct and usable in written English.
It is most commonly used to apologize for an unintentional mistake. For example: After I sent the email to the wrong person, I wrote a follow-up email saying "Sorry for the error."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"sorry for the error", follow up with a brief explanation of what the error was and how it's being corrected. This shows accountability and provides context.
Common error
Avoid repeatedly saying "sorry for the error" without specifying the mistake or indicating corrective actions. Vague apologies can seem insincere and unhelpful.

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
Apologies for the mistake
Replaces "error" with "mistake", offering a slightly more informal tone.
My apologies for the error
Adds a personal pronoun for emphasis, making the apology slightly more direct.
We regret the error
Uses "regret" to express sorrow, suitable for more formal settings.
We apologize for the mistake
A more formal phrasing using "apologize" instead of "sorry".
We take responsibility for the error
Emphasizes accountability for the mistake.
Our mistake, we apologize
Inverts the sentence structure for emphasis, while maintaining the apology.
We messed up, sorry about that
A casual and informal expression of apology.
I was wrong, my bad
Highly informal, acknowledging fault and apologizing.
Excuse the error
A polite way of asking for understanding after a mistake.
Pardon our mistake
Similar to "excuse the error", but slightly more formal.
FAQs
What is the best way to use "sorry for the error" in a sentence?
Use "sorry for the error" to acknowledge a mistake, followed by a clarification or correction. For example, "Sorry for the error; the correct date is July 16th."
What can I say instead of "sorry for the error"?
You can use alternatives like "apologies for the mistake", "my apologies for the error", or "we regret the error" depending on the context.
Is it more professional to say "sorry for the error" or "apologies for the mistake"?
Apologies for the mistake is generally considered more formal and professional, while "sorry for the error" is suitable for most contexts.
How can I make my apology more sincere when saying "sorry for the error"?
To make your apology more sincere, be specific about the error, explain why it happened (if appropriate), and describe the steps you're taking to prevent it in the future. A simple "sorry for the error" can feel insufficient without context.
